Abstract

A general framework for the field-theoretic thermodynamic uncertainty relation was recently proposed and illustrated with the (1+1) dimensional Kardar-Parisi-Zhang equation. In the present paper, the analytical results obtained there in the weak coupling limit are tested via a direct numerical simulation of the KPZ equation with good agreement. The accuracy of the numerical results varies with the respective choice of discretization of the KPZ non-linearity. Whereas the numerical simulations strongly support the analytical predictions, an inherent limitation to the accuracy of the approximation to the total entropy production is found. In an analytical treatment of a generalized discretization of the KPZ non-linearity, the origin of this limitation is explained and shown to be an intrinsic property of the employed discretization scheme.
